MARVELL 88PACR02-BAM2: Advanced Gigabit Ethernet PHY Transceiver for Next-Generation Network Infrastructure

The exponential growth in data consumption, driven by cloud computing, IoT proliferation, and high-bandwidth applications, demands a robust and intelligent network foundation. At the heart of this modern infrastructure lies the physical layer (PHY) transceiver, a critical component that dictates the performance, efficiency, and reliability of data transmission. The MARVELL 88PACR02-BAM2 stands out as a premier Gigabit Ethernet PHY transceiver engineered specifically to meet the stringent requirements of next-generation enterprise, carrier, and data center networks.

This highly integrated single-port device is far more than a simple interface converter. It is built on advanced process technology that enables superior performance while optimizing power consumption—a crucial factor for high-density switch and router designs where thermal management is paramount. The transceiver supports 1000BASE-T, 100BASE-TX, and 10BASE-Te operations over standard CAT-5e cabling, ensuring backward compatibility and protecting existing infrastructure investments.

A key differentiator of the 88PACR02-BAM2 is its sophisticated suite of Signal Integrity and Diagnostic capabilities. It incorporates Marvell's patented technology to mitigate the effects of crosstalk and electromagnetic interference (EMI), ensuring a clear and stable signal even in electrically noisy environments. Furthermore, it features advanced cable diagnostics that can precisely pinpoint faults—such as open circuits, short circuits, and cable length measurements—dramatically reducing network downtime and simplifying maintenance.

Beyond raw performance, the device is architected for intelligence and control. It offers comprehensive Energy Efficient Ethernet (EEE) support, complying with the IEEE 802.3az standard. This allows the PHY to enter a low-power idle state during periods of low data activity, significantly reducing overall system power consumption without sacrificing operational readiness. For network managers, this translates to lower operational costs and a reduced carbon footprint.

The 88PACR02-BAM2 also simplifies design-in with a flexible interface and robust management features. Its configurable MAC interface supports multiple operational modes, providing design versatility. Integrated Digital Signal Processing (DSP) enhances data recovery and transmission accuracy, ensuring high reliability under varying load conditions.
